Output e26dbe8ad0a8f94d88a7c368dc6e2d85f150dc75072ce4579227ee8956233d78:25

value
322213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db308ef933003c60c11e2c46fc3c3281b6bf6c7 OP_EQUAL
address
3EcFg9xEPRGyMqhHPmVxFYpvGZTNwmYXpu
transaction
e26dbe8ad0a8f94d88a7c368dc6e2d85f150dc75072ce4579227ee8956233d78
spent
true